The exception to timely firearm return in Baker Act cases is provided by which Florida Statute number?

Explanation:
When someone is subject to a Baker Act, safety concerns can justify delaying the return of any firearms that were seized. The rule that provides this specific exception is found in Florida Statute 790.401. This statute creates an exception to the standard, timely return requirement by acknowledging that during Baker Act proceedings, it may be necessary to retain the firearm longer to protect the person and others while the involuntary examination and related processes unfold. The other statutes listed relate to different firearm offenses or regulations and do not establish this Baker Act–specific exception.
